Role of Grease Interceptors in Restaurant Kitchens

Grease interceptors sit near dishwashing areas to catch FOG (fats, oils, and grease) before they enter the sewer. This is crucial for preventing pollution and safeguarding the wastewater system. Effective grease trap maintenance guarantees these units work efficiently, preserving the ecosystem and the business from penalties or interruptions. Regular reviews are essential to adhering to grease interceptor rules, which specify cleaning and upkeep schedules.

Kitchen Grease Trap Cleaning: A Step-by-Step Procedure

Sanitizing a grease interceptor is vital for a kitchen’s efficiency. It needs the right equipment and a organized process. From collecting needed tools to discarding refuse appropriately, each step is essential for a functional kitchen.

Essential Equipment for DIY Cleaning

Before you commence, make sure you have these tools at ready:

  • Protective gloves
  • Respirator
  • Lever or wrench
  • Scrapers
  • Shop vac

Comprehensive Cleaning Process

Here’s a step-by-step guide for efficient cleaning:

  1. Lift the grease interceptor by lifting its cover carefully.
  2. Extract the debris, aiming to take out as much as you can.
  3. Use a shop vacuum to extract any remaining pieces.
  4. Wash the inside of the grease interceptor with mild soaps.
  5. Wash away all debris with clean liquid.

Symptoms Your Grease Interceptor Requires Sanitization

Maintaining your grease interceptor in optimal shape is crucial for your restaurant kitchen’s efficient functioning. Understanding when to schedule a grease trap cleaning can avert future problems. Several indicators can notify you to the necessity for an inspection.

Usual Signs of FOG Accumulation

Be aware of these symptoms that indicate your grease interceptor requires prompt action:

  • Offensive scents emanating from the culinary area or pipes.
  • Slow-moving basins, suggesting obstructions from grease buildup.
  • Apparent FOG buildup in and around your drains.
  • Regular pipe problems, such as clogs and backups.

Recommended Cleaning Frequency

Consistent upkeep of your grease trap is vital for efficiency and conformity to standards. It’s usually advised to conduct checks and cleanings every four to six weeks. Culinary areas with intense demand might need more routine attention. Hiring a professional for consistent grease interceptor maintenance ensures you comply with these standards and maintain your kitchen sanitary.

Culinary Area Type Suggested Sanitization Interval
Light Demand Four to six weeks
Medium Usage Every 3-4 weeks
High Usage One to two weeks
